Selectivity (Fall 2021): The Numbers Behind Student Admissions
Open Admissions
No
Selectivity of College
Less Selective
Acceptance Rate
84%
Acceptance and Enrollment Stats (Fall 2021)
Applicant Total
3,554
Accepted
2,971
Enrolled
647
Gender Balance in Admissions: Analyzing Male and Female Applicant Trends
Applicants: Men - Women 30 to 70
Accepted: Men - Women 30 to 70
Enrolled: Men - Women 31 to 69
Average Test Scores
About 19% of students accepted to Findlay submitted their SAT scores. When looking at the 25th through the 75th percentile, SAT Evidence-Based Reading and Writing scores ranged between 510 and 613. Math scores were between 500 and 600.
SAT Reading and Writing Scores for The University of Findlay ( 510 to 613 )
SAT Math Scores for The University of Findlay ( 500 to 600 )
Findlay received ACT scores from 72% of accepted students. When looking at the 25th through the 75th percentile, ACT Composite scores ranged between 19 and 26.
ACT Composite Scores for The University of Findlay ( 19 to 26 )
